Personalized packaging production system

A personalized packaging production system includes an in-feed tray, an out-feed tray, a cutting table disposed intermediate the in-feed tray and the out-feed tray and an interchangeable cutting/creasing assembly. A sheet feeder is positioned between the in-feed tray and the cutting table to feed media sheets from the in-feed tray to the cutting table, and an exit nip is positioned between the out-feed tray and the cutting table to remove media sheets from the cutting table to the out-feed tray.

MACHINE FOR MAKING BOX BLANKS
20180178475 · 2018-06-28 ·

In at least one embodiment, a machine for making a box blank from a sheet of box-making material includes a frame, a plurality of rollers, coupled to the frame, for moving the sheet along a material handling path, and a rail coupled to the frame adjacent to the material handling path. The machine further includes a carriage assembly including a first motor and a blade selectively deployable by the first motor, a second motor that, via a linkage, moves the carriage assembly along the rail, and a control circuit that controls the first and second motors to selectively deploy the blade to cut the sheet to form a box blank.

Packaging machine infeed, separation, and creasing mechanisms

A machine for forming packing templates includes a infeed mechanism that can feed multiple feeds of sheet material into the machine without repositioning the infeed mechanism or forming creases or bends in the sheet material. The machine also includes a separation and cutting systems with one or more cutting tables and biased knives that cut the sheet material packaging templates. The machine also includes creasing roller(s) that forms creases in the sheet material. The machine also includes a system for reducing or eliminating the impact of irregularities in the sheet material.

COLLAPSIBLE BOX MAKING EQUIPMENT
20170173912 · 2017-06-22 ·

A manufacturing process to produce a collapsible box, wherein a prefabricated cardboard having a plurality of collapsing lines along a center line and a plurality of scoring lines, wherein said center line divided the prefabricated cardboard into two parts, wherein said process comprises of steps of feeding section to feed said prefabricated cardboard sheet into an apparatus; folding section to fold a set of wings along said scoring line in the cardboard sheet; dispensing section to dispense an adhesive to an adhesive line; collapsing section to form the cardboard into a collapsing box by pushing a mandrel downwardly into said collapsing lines; and rolling section to compress the collapsing box.

Device and method for forming a container by folding

A device for forming a container by folding a cardboard sheet having a lid and notably a tab. The forming device comprising a conveyor driving said cardboard sheet in a direction of travel and a device for folding over said lid. The folding-over device comprises a pressing surface for pressing on said lid, and the pressing surface is configured to move from an initial position toward a deployed position of folding said lid, and vice versa. The said pressing surface is mobile in said direction of travel, and comprises an endless belt motorized in said direction of travel.

APPARATUS FOR PROCESSING SHEETS

An apparatus for processing sheets includes a conveyor that conveys a sheet on which a plurality of fold lines are set, a folder that folds the sheet conveyed by the conveyor along the fold lines, an applicator that applies an adhesive to the sheet and a controller configured to control the conveyor, the folder, and the applicator. The controller includes an acquirer configured to acquire processing information of the sheet, a fold line determinator configured to determine, based on the processing information acquired by the acquirer, which one of the plurality of fold lines along which the sheet is to be folded by the folder and a folding controller configured to control the folder to fold the sheet in accordance with determination of the fold line determinator.
